On March 2, 1962, Chamberlain led the Warriors to victory over the Knicks by scoring 100 points, the most ever in an NBA game. Chamberlain shot 36-for-63 from the field, setting the record for most shots made and attempted in a single game, and went 28-for-32 from the free throw line in the Philadelphia Warriors' 169-147 win over the. David Robinson of the San Antonio Spurs entered the final game of the 1993-1994 season trailing a young Orlando Magic center named Shaquille O'Neal for the scoring title by percentage points. Baylor scored 71 points to lead the Los Angeles Lakers to a 123-108 win over the New York Knicks, which remains the highest scoring individual performance in the history of Madison Square Garden, new or old.
